I bought one on there in the last auction. It went well over reserve, but not all of them do. You can mostly tell beforehand which ones will.
I sent a written bid in as I had passed the internet registration deadline.
The best advice is don't buying a "naff" plate (one that you need to explain), or one that needs mis-spacing (as the police are getting stricter over time).

You also have to pay vat, 7.5% buyers premium & the £80 fee on the closing price
How long do you have until you have to put it on a car?
Yes that's right, I forgot the add-on charges.
You have 1 year to put it on a car. You can renew the period for a £25 fee though. Plates are a nice little earner for the government.
